首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

丢失从共包装函数传递到另一个函数的参数

是指在函数调用过程中,参数的传递出现了错误或丢失的情况,导致接收函数无法获取到正确的参数值。

这种情况可能出现在函数调用链中的任何一个环节,包括前端开发、后端开发、软件测试等各个阶段。常见的导致参数丢失的原因包括但不限于以下几种:

  1. 参数未正确传递:在函数调用时,未正确传递参数或传递的参数与函数定义的参数不匹配,导致接收函数无法获取到正确的参数值。
  2. 参数类型错误:在函数调用时,传递的参数类型与函数定义的参数类型不匹配,导致接收函数无法正确处理参数。
  3. 参数命名冲突:在函数调用链中,存在多个函数使用相同的参数名,导致参数值被覆盖或混淆,无法正确传递到目标函数。
  4. 参数被修改或丢失:在函数调用链中的某个环节,对参数进行了修改或丢失,导致接收函数无法获取到正确的参数值。

为了避免丢失从共包装函数传递到另一个函数的参数,可以采取以下几种措施:

  1. 仔细检查函数调用:在函数调用时,确保参数的正确传递和匹配,避免传递错误的参数或参数类型不匹配。
  2. 使用参数检查和验证:在接收函数中,对传入的参数进行检查和验证,确保参数的正确性和完整性。
  3. 使用参数命名规范:在函数调用链中,使用有意义的参数命名,并避免参数命名冲突,以确保参数值能够正确传递到目标函数。
  4. 使用参数传递方式:根据具体情况,选择适当的参数传递方式,如值传递、引用传递或指针传递,以确保参数能够正确传递和使用。

腾讯云提供了一系列云计算相关的产品和服务,其中包括云函数(Serverless Cloud Function)和云原生应用平台(Tencent Kubernetes Engine,TKE)等。云函数是一种无需管理服务器即可运行代码的计算服务,可用于处理函数间的参数传递。云原生应用平台是腾讯云提供的一种基于Kubernetes的容器化应用管理平台,可用于构建和管理云原生应用。

更多关于腾讯云产品的详细介绍和使用方法,您可以访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券